Output 122bd3d1da5abcd68961832c4d2ab7cbec9242e74c8892a875c3f9c5f18abb03:4

value
845860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 504940642b2901b4359fedb49c12327c0093f6eb OP_EQUAL
address
391XjVhVJavwCZUBwi72YkB1C1ZQj6V1ne
transaction
122bd3d1da5abcd68961832c4d2ab7cbec9242e74c8892a875c3f9c5f18abb03
spent
true